About Xianying Cao

Xianying Cao is a scholar working on General Engineering, Biomaterials and Orthodontics, having authored 57 papers that have together received 803 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(11 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(9 papers) and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(177 citations), Pharmaceutical Science (47 citations) and Molecular Medicine (37 citations). Xianying Cao has collaborated with scholars based in China, Australia and Malaysia. Frequent co-authors include Shipu Li, Ke Jiang, Honglian Dai, Yingchao Han, Ling Zhang, Yixia Yin, Tong Qiu, Youfa Wang, Xinyu Wang and Lin Yuan.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Scientific Reports.
